JOB SUMMARY:
The Office Manager is responsible for providing administrative support to the President/Vice President or Director and the management team. Ensuring that all support and service is conducted and fulfilled in a manner consistent with the goals and objectives of the division.

This position requires onsite attendance 5 days per week in Fairfax, Virginia.  
 

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Coordinate and monitor the actions of office administration staff members to ensure communication is consistent and work assignments are completed.

  • Interface directly with customers or residents in responding to and resolving questions, concerns and complaints relating to the affairs of the community/division.

  • Ensure office staff is informed of administrative policies and procedures and reflects status of management functions at all times. Develop and implement office procedures and programs and provide assistance to other managers as required.

  • Research, compile and summarize a variety of management project reports and informational materials. Compose original correspondence, memos and division reports. Interact and make recommendations with other department heads in the preparation of budget and staffing requirements. Also, maintain financial charts and graphs as identified by the (Pres./VP/ Director).

  • Handle the purchase and implementation of office furniture and infrastructure.

  • Conduct new hire orientation for all new employees in assigned area of responsibility.

  • Assist in handling calls and other administrative duties; e.g., typing, filing, etc., when the office workload requires

REQUIRED EDUCATION:

  • Minimum Bachelor’s degree in related field

REQUIRED EXPERIENCE:

  • Minimum 3-5 years’ experience in staff supervision.  

  • Minimum 5 years’ experience with office management, business management, and written verbal task experience

  • Knowledge of Association business affairs and/or community governance.  Hands-on experience with word processing equipment

  • Ability to develop and implement methods and procedures for improving, maintaining, and facilitating personnel processes.  Good organizational skills and delegation ability.

  • Strong verbal and written communication skills

SALARY RANGE:

$85,000 $100,000 annually depending upon experience.

This position is also eligible for an annual bonus incentive based on the successful completion of defined performance objectives.

GENERAL DESCRIPTION OF BENEFITS:
Employees are eligible to participate in the Company’s 401(k) Plan. Employees (and their families) are eligible for medical, dental, and vision insurance coverage. Employees are covered by company-paid disability and basic life insurance. Voluntary insurance coverage options, including critical illness and hospital indemnity, are also available. In addition, the Company offers an Employee Assistance Program and tuition reimbursement (as applicable). In addition to up to 9 paid company holidays per year, employees with less than 10 years of service are eligible for up to 23 paid days off and employees with 10 or more years of service are eligible for up to 28 paid days off.
